Transaction f2ab307617476726bfacfb3b3253d43bc7b1ee8e5d7492687d570e2bbeb3171a
1 Input
2 Outputs
- f2ab307617476726bfacfb3b3253d43bc7b1ee8e5d7492687d570e2bbeb3171a:0
- f2ab307617476726bfacfb3b3253d43bc7b1ee8e5d7492687d570e2bbeb3171a:1
value 81484
address 1CJCpAgxbVSs1GHDBRsEW1jnUdDNv9MBdT
value 858070
address 39es9Aeewt9CbCuFGTSj5ukDTWUaNFAN4r